How do we train our people the right way from day one and how do we get them involved?
Every company is different, we need to remember that the length of our training cycle is dependent on how much of a product offering you have. Whatever the case may be, we must make certain that we provide them with accurate information.
In this episode, Oliver and Jason talk about the onboarding training, the start of somebody’s journey, and making it relevant.
Learn more about induction training, proof of learning, and also how we ensure that your people’s attention is maintained from the beginning to the end of the training process.
